Seems Jeff Sharlet, author of ”The Family: The Secret Fundamentalism at the Heart of American Power,” has been a go-to guy on the secretive organization, especially since some prominent Republicans tied to recent scandals have links to it.

He was featured this week in a roundtable discussion that appears on Religion Dispatches.

He also was the topic of a three-part Q&A from EthicsDaily this week. One tidbit in the first part was that he said the attention he and others have given the secretive organization _ known for holding the annual National Prayer Breakfast _ has prompted a change in access to the Billy Graham Center archives at Wheaton College in Illinois.


Says Sharlet: “As for the archives, the historical papers are still open, but the more contemporary stuff is closed, restricted following my Harper’s story, a major investigative piece for the L.A. Times and research by some foreign journalists.”

In part three, he predicts that The Family’s leadership may fade but its ideas may not.
